Q. I'm interested in subscribing to a journal. Is it possible to view a free sample copy or have a free trial?
A. Online sample copies are available for all of our learned journals. Non-subscribing institutions and individuals are also eligible for a two month free trial of the online edition. For print sample copies, please send your request to Customer Services, specifying the journal that you are interested in.

Q. I think I am missing an issue for a journal for which I have a subscription.
A. Please send your claim request to Customer Services, including as many relevant details as you can to speed up the enquiry. Claims need to be made within four months of publication. Please ensure that we have your correct delivery address for future issues.

Q. I want to subscribe to a journal but it is half way through the year – what will happen?
A. The Pharmaceutical Journal, and Clinical Pharmacist operate on an anytime start basis. This means that you will start receiving issues straight away after your subscription has been processed (please be aware that labels are run in advance so it can take two weeks after your order is placed before the first issue is sent). You will then receive all issues for the following 12 months. A renewal notice will be sent at the end of your subscription period.

All other journals only offer subscriptions on a calendar year basis i.e. the subscription period begins in January of each year. If you subscribe at any point after the first issue has been published we will send you the back issues from that calendar (volume) year. You will then continue to receive journal issues as they are published. A renewal notice will be sent towards the end of the calendar year.,

Q. Is it possible to buy a single journal issue or article?
A. Yes, single print issues are available for purchase. Individual articles may also be purchased by non-subscribers on a pay-per-view basis.

Q. Do you offer multi-site/global licences for journals?
A. Yes, customised prices are available on application. Please contact the Journals Sales Manager for a quotation.

Q. I have a personal subscription to a journal – can I access the online edition?
A. Individual subscriptions are to the print edition only. You can browse or search article abstracts online for free and you may purchase individual articles on a pay-per-view basis.

Q. I think my institution has a subscription to a journal - how do I get access to the full text of articles?
A. If your institution has a subscription and you are accessing the journal from an institutional computer, your IP address should be recognised and the appropriate access enabled automatically. If you believe that your institution has a subscription but you are unable to access the full text, please contact the person that manages your institution's subscriptions.
